Helping You Find Meaningful Work

Corbrook’s Employment Services support youth and adults with developmental disabilities in building skills, finding a job, and thriving at work. Our Employment Specialists provide personalized coaching, job development, and ongoing support so you can reach your employment goals.

As a proud Employment Ontario service provider, we offer free, accessible programs designed to help you prepare for work and succeed in the workplace.


What We Offer

Job Seeker Services

  • One-on-one employment planning

  • Resume and cover letter support

  • Interview preparation

  • Job search coaching

  • Job matching and placement

  • On-the-job training and job coaching

  • Retention support to help you stay employed

  • Computer and technology skills training

  • Assistance with transportation or mobility needs

Pre-Employment Training: “Striving for Success”

Our specialized pre-employment program helps build workplace confidence and essential skills, including:

  • Workplace expectations and etiquette

  • Health & wellness for work

  • Communication and teamwork

  • Resume building & interview practice

  • Soft skills for long-term success

Employment Ontario Programs

Corbrook is an official Employment Ontario service provider, offering:

  • Skills and interest assessments

  • Job search and job-readiness supports

  • Job placement and retention services

  • Referrals to community and training resources

  • Access to Better Jobs Ontario for eligible job seekers needing retraining

Our programs are accessible to individuals with developmental disabilities and include no-cost options for those who qualify.
Fee-for-service options are also available.
